Talo - Pros & Cons

Pros

  • βœ“Sub-2-second latency keeps conversations flowing naturally without awkward pauses common in interpreter-assisted calls
  • βœ“Native integration with Zoom, Google Meet, and Teams means no separate app or browser extension is required for participants
  • βœ“Dual output modes (audio overlay and captions) accommodate different meeting formats and participant preferences
  • βœ“Custom glossary support ensures accurate translation of industry-specific terminology and brand names
  • βœ“Free tier available for users to evaluate translation quality before committing to a paid plan

Cons

  • βœ—Translation accuracy can degrade with heavy accents, overlapping speakers, or poor audio quality β€” a limitation shared by all real-time ASR-based tools
  • βœ—The free tier's 30-minute monthly limit is restrictive and realistically only supports evaluation, not ongoing use
  • βœ—Less common language pairs (e.g., Finnish to Vietnamese) may have noticeably lower translation quality compared to high-resource pairs like English-Spanish
  • βœ—Audio overlay mode can sound robotic compared to professional human interpreters, which may not suit high-stakes diplomatic or executive meetings

Wordly - Pros & Cons

Pros

  • βœ“Supports 60+ languages and dialects with real-time translation, covering a broad range of global communication needs
  • βœ“No app installation required for attendeesβ€”works entirely in the browser, reducing friction and IT support burden
  • βœ“Integrates natively with Zoom, Microsoft Teams, Webex, and major event platforms for seamless deployment
  • βœ“Significantly lower cost than hiring professional human interpreters, making multilingual events feasible on limited budgets
  • βœ“Custom glossary feature allows organizations to improve accuracy for industry-specific or technical terminology
  • βœ“Provides both translated captions and translated audio output, accommodating different attendee preferences

Cons

  • βœ—AI translation quality does not match professional human interpreters for nuanced, high-stakes, or highly idiomatic content
  • βœ—Pricing is not publicly transparentβ€”requires contacting sales for a quote, making quick cost comparisons difficult
  • βœ—Translation accuracy can degrade with poor audio quality, heavy accents, or overlapping speakers in noisy environments
  • βœ—Less suitable for sensitive legal, medical, or diplomatic contexts where translation errors carry significant consequences
  • βœ—Dependent on stable internet connectivity for both the speaker's audio feed and attendee caption delivery
